MARMION

Shipbuilder (Footdee, Aberdeen)
DateJune 1826
Object NameSCHOONER
MediumWOOD
ClassificationsShip
Dimensionslength 56'8" x breadth 18'1" x depth 10'8"
gross tonnage 78 tons
Object numberABDSHIP000933
About MeYard: Alexander Hall & Co
Yard Number: 47

Fate: unknown, last in Lloyd's 1839 (M277)

Propulsion: Sail
Description: Schooner rigged, 1 deck, 2 masts, square stern, carvel built, no galleries or figurehead, standing bowsprit

Owners:
1826: Registered at Aberdeen for subscribing owners;
George Thomson, insurance broker, 16 shares; WIlliam Minto, shipbuilder, 8 shares; John Morgan, shipmaster, 4 shares; all Aberdeen.
Other shareholders in 1826:
William Maitland, rope & sailmaker, 8 shares; Alexander Hall, shipbuilder, 8 shares; George Leslie, shipmaster, 8 shares; Alexander Cumming, timber merchant, 4 shares; John Williamson, flesher, 4 shares; John Hall, book keeper, 34 shares; all Aberdeen.
(Source: Aberdeen Register of Shipping (Aberdeen City Archives))
1835: Smith & co, registered at Stonehaven
1838: D. Smith, registered at Montrose

Masters:
1830-33: Master Struther
1834-38: Master J. Laird
1838-39: Master Chambers

Voyages:
1830-33: Lynn (King's Lynn)
1834-38: Aberdeen - London
1838-39: Montrose coaster

General History:
15/01/1839:
Montrose 11 Jan. - On the evening of the 6th inst. and throughout the next day, it blew a hurricane from WNW, during which, while the MARMION, Chambers, was taking the River, she missed stays, and went amongst the rocks, but was got off on the evening of the 8th, apparently without much damage.
(Lloyd's List)

Note: Cost of construction £705
